Types of Student Accommodation

Sydney has a wide variety of student accommodation options to suit different preferences and budgets. Knowing about these choices can make it much easier to find the right place.

Shared Apartments

These are popular among students who enjoy socialising and reducing living costs by sharing rent and utilities. Shared apartments provide communal living spaces like kitchens and lounges, fostering a sense of community.

Private Rooms

Offering more privacy than shared apartments, private rooms allow students to have personal space while still benefiting from shared amenities. This option is ideal for those who prioritise solitude without completely isolating themselves from a community setting.

Studios and Ensuites

For students seeking complete independence, studios or en-suites present an all-inclusive solution. They typically come with a personal kitchen and bathroom, offering maximum privacy. Popular Locations for Student Rentals

Finding the right location is crucial when searching for student rentals in Sydney. Proximity to major universities such as the University of Sydney and UNSW can significantly enhance your experience. Consider areas like Newtown, which offers a vibrant atmosphere just a stone’s throw from the University of Sydney. Its central activity hub ensures easy access to public transport, making it convenient for students.

For those attending UNSW, Kensington is a popular choice. This suburb not only provides easy access to campus but also boasts a lively environment filled with cafes and parks. Its proximity to public transport networks further enhances its appeal, offering seamless connectivity to other parts of Sydney.

Haymarket, located near the University of Technology Sydney, is another attractive option. Known for its bustling markets and cultural diversity, Haymarket provides a unique living experience with excellent transport links through buses and metro services.

Pricing Considerations for Student Housing in Sydney

Understanding the student accommodation pricing landscape in Sydney is crucial for budgeting effectively. Prices vary significantly, generally ranging from AU$200 to AU$1000 per week, depending on several factors.

Factors Influencing Pricing

  • Location: Proximity to major universities and vibrant areas like Haymarket and Kensington can drive up prices but offer convenience in return.
  • Type of Accommodation: Options range from shared apartments to private studios. For instance, OTTO offers luxurious yet affordable options with modern amenities that might influence your decision.

Tips for Budget-Friendly Options

  • Compare Providers: Research major providers such as Campus Living Villages, Scape, Iglu, and Amber Student to find competitive rates.
  • Flexible Lease Terms: Opt for accommodations offering flexible lease terms to manage financial commitments better.
  • Shared Living: Consider sharing apartments to split costs and enjoy a community atmosphere.
